Adrien Petit is Yamaha bLU cRU Masterclass winner
In Spain, Yamaha Motor Europe announced the winners for the 2021 season during the 2022 bLU cRU Masterclass. Frenchman Adrien Petit will compete in the European 125cc Championship next season with Team Ausio-Yamaha-Yamalube. The 16-year-old rider was chosen after previously winning the bLU cRU Superfinal 125cc in Mantova. The Swiss Noe Zumstein (13) has been chosen as the winner in the 85cc class and Bertram Thorius (11) has been chosen as the 65cc rider on behalf of Yamaha.
